Predator

 

An animal (E.g. a shark, dolphin, or human) that naturally hunts and eats other animals.

Pollution

 

The contamination (making less pure) of air, water, or soil due to harmful substances, usually as a result of human activities. There are different types of pollution, for example: chemical pollution, light pollution, or noise pollution.

Ray

 

A fish with a flattened diamond-shaped body, and a long, poisonous, barbed spine at the base of it's tail.

Harbour

 

A place on the coast where ships can safely anchor because it is protected from rough water, wind, and sea currents.
